Pyidaungsu is a Unicode-compliant font. Unlike older fonts (like Zawgyi), it follows international standards. This ensures that text displays correctly on all devices, from smartphones to desktop computers, without "broken" characters. Key Benefits Uniformity: Used by all Myanmar government offices. Standardization: Follows the official Unicode 11.0 standard.
